4.02.08 Checking radiator
1 Switch off diesel engine and remove ignition key.
2 Allow machine to cool down to a temperature under 30 °C (86 °F).
3 Check the cooling fins of the radiator for contamination.
NOTE
If the radiator is contaminated it must be cleaned thoroughly
and immediately.
4 Loosen the fastening screws [A], and remove the cladding [B].
5 Clean the radiator [C] carefully using a power washer, and while
proceeding from inside to outside.
6 Mount the cladding [B] and tighten fastening screws [A].
4.02.09 Checking coolant level
1. Switch off diesel engine and remove ignition key.
2. Only check the coolant level when the diesel engine is cold.
3. Correct coolant level: Centre of inspection glass [A] on compensator
tank. Do not exceed this level!
4. In case of a lack of coolant, only fill up coolant in the specified
concentration through filling opening [B] at the compensator tank.
5. In case of bigger coolant losses, find out and eliminate the cause.
